Input validation vulnerability in Solace Extra 1.3.0

The Solace Extra plugin for WordPress has a security issue that allows attackers to upload any type of file onto a website using the plugin. This can be done by someone who is logged in with Subscriber-level access or higher, and it could potentially allow them to remotely execute code on the website.

Detected in:

Solace Extra fixed vulnerable versions: >= * <= 1.3.0
